Teijin to Switch PET Bottle Recycling Operations from “Bottle to BottleTM” to “Bottle to Fiber”

Teijin Limited announced today that it has suspended its Bottle to BottleTM PET bottle recycling program in favor of Bottle to Fiber operations, the latter incorporating the same technology as that used to reclaim polyester fibers.

Cereplast to Supply Bioresin for Cadacoís Enviro-Bloxô Building Toys

Cereplast, Inc. (OTCBB:CERP), manufacturer of proprietary bio-based sustainable plastics, today announced it has started to supply compostable resin for a new line of environmentally-friendly toys developed by Cadaco, one of America’s oldest independent game and toy companies.

ExxonMobil Chemical’s Vistamaxx Specialty Elastomers and Resins Achieve FDA and EU-Directive Compliance

ExxonMobil Chemical’s Vistamaxx specialty elastomers and resinstargeted at flexible and rigid food packaging applications have received approval from the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) under the Food Contact Notification process.

Sales Contract for Hunsfos signed

As part of their announced strategic re-orientation, focussing on clay-coated speciality grade papers, Cham Paper Group has signed a contract for the sale of their Norwegian company, Hunsfos Fabrikker AS.

Indiana State Capital Cafeterias to Switch to Bio-Based Products Made from Cereplast Resin

Cereplast, Inc. (OTCBB: CERP), manufacturer of proprietary bio-based, sustainable plastics, today announced that Indiana Government Center’s cafeterias will be adopting bio-based plastic containers made from Cereplast compostables(R) resins.
